The net worth of Waterdrop ADR is the difference between its total assets and liabilities. Waterdrop ADR's net worth represents the value of the company's equity or ownership interest. In other words, it is the amount of money that would be left over if all of Waterdrop ADR's assets were sold and all of its debts were paid off. Net worth is sometimes referred to as shareholder's equity or book value. Waterdrop ADR's net worth can be used as a measure of its financial health and stability which can help investors to decide if Waterdrop ADR is a good investment. It is also essential in determining the company's creditworthiness and ability to secure financing before investing in Waterdrop ADR stock.

Waterdrop ADR's net worth analysis, or its valuation, is the process of determining the total value of the company. This involves assessing a range of factors, including Waterdrop ADR's financial performance, assets, liabilities, and potential for growth. The ultimate goal is to provide a clear understanding of Waterdrop ADR's overall worth, which can help investors make informed investment decisions. There are several methods that can be used to perform Waterdrop ADR's net worth analysis. One common approach is to calculate Waterdrop ADR's market capitalization.Another approach is to use the price-to-earnings ratio (P/E ratio), which compares Waterdrop ADR's stock price to its earnings per share (EPS). Discounted cash flow (DCF) analysis is another popular method for assessing Waterdrop ADR's net worth. This approach calculates the present value of Waterdrop ADR's future cash flows, taking into account factors such as growth rate, profitability, and risk. By comparing the present value of Waterdrop ADR's cash flows to its current stock price, investors can gain a better understanding of the company's overall value. Finally, investors may use comparable company analysis to evaluate Waterdrop ADR's net worth. This involves comparing Waterdrop ADR's financial metrics to similar companies in the same industry. By identifying companies with similar financial characteristics, investors can gain insight into Waterdrop ADR's net worth relative to its peers.

Waterdrop ADR time-series forecasting models is one of many Waterdrop ADR's stock analysis techniques aimed to predict future share value based on previously observed values. Time-series forecasting models ae widely used for non-stationary data. Non-stationary data are called the data whose statistical properties e.g. the mean and standard deviation are not constant over time but instead, these metrics vary over time. These non-stationary Waterdrop ADR's historical data is usually called time-series. Some empirical experimentation suggests that the statistical forecasting models outperform the models based exclusively on fundamental analysis to predict the direction of the market movement and maximize returns from investment trading.

The market value of Waterdrop ADR is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of Waterdrop that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of Waterdrop ADR's value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is Waterdrop ADR's true underlying value. Investors use various methods to calculate intrinsic value and buy a stock when its market value falls below its intrinsic value. Because Waterdrop ADR's market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ect Waterdrop ADR's under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Please note, there is a significant difference between Waterdrop ADR's value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Waterdrop ADR is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, Waterdrop ADR's price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
